Somerset, Ky —
Mary Zella Wiggington Lee, 88, formerly of Somerset, Ky., died peacefully on May 4, 2010.
She was the daughter of the late Dr. J.D. Wiggington and Soloma Bralley Wiggington. Mary and her late husband, Arthur J. Lee, were well-known restaurateurs in Dallas. After moving from Chicago they opened the Beefeater Inn, known for its Velvet Hammers, in 1961, and the Oporto Oyster Bar and Seafood restaurant in 1971.
After the passing of her husband, Mary donated an ambulance to the Dallas Fire Department, becoming an Honorary Fire Chief on Nov. 14, 1977. Mary was also instrumental in legalizing horse racing in Texas.
She is survived by her niece, Lynne Burgess. Preceding Mary in death were two sisters.
